Howard County Arkansas Land Cover Map Shows a Forested North and Agricultural Southeast

The Howard County Arkansas Land Cover Map shows a county that is more than half forest in 2025, yet its surface changes noticeably from north to south. Forest accounts for 50.69% of the mapped cover, followed by agriculture at 22.70%, shrubland at 8.63%, developed land at 6.64%, grassland at 4.81%, wetlands at 4.68%, and water at 1.29%. Broad wooded areas dominate the northern and central parts of the county, while agriculture becomes more extensive toward the southeast. Developed patches stand out around a few settlement areas even though they occupy a much smaller share of the county as a whole.

Land cover describes what is physically present on the ground as classified from remote-sensing data; it does not establish zoning, ownership, parcel boundaries, or whether a site can legally be developed.

The 2025 summary makes the county’s broad pattern easy to see. Forest is the largest class at 50.69%, more than twice the 22.70% agricultural share. Shrubland contributes another 8.63%, and grassland 4.81%, so open or partly wooded cover is common between the larger forest and farming areas. Developed land represents 6.64%, wetlands 4.68%, and water 1.29%. A small barren component is present as well, but it is not one of the leading categories shown in the county summary.

Northern Howard County is especially wooded. Agricultural areas appear there as smaller breaks among large forest patches, whereas the southeast contains much broader fields and open cover. The central part of the county mixes forest, agriculture, shrubland, and developed land more closely. That transition is important because a countywide percentage alone cannot show where each class occurs; the same 50.69% forest figure looks very different when the distribution is considered.

The Association of Arkansas Counties describes Howard County as roughly 600 square miles and notes that farming has long been important to the local economy. It also identifies Nashville as the county seat. Those regional facts help place the mapped agricultural cover and larger settlement footprint in context, but the classification does not identify individual crops or determine whether a particular field is actively farmed in the current season.

The forest-and-farmland view removes some of the complexity of the full classification and makes the county’s main contrast easier to follow. Forest still covers 50.69% and agriculture 22.70%, with shrubland at 8.63%, grassland at 4.81%, wetlands at 4.68%, and water at 1.29%. Dark green dominates much of the northern half, while cropland and pasture/hay colors become more common farther south and east.

Wetland and water colors appear along parts of the western side and near the southern end of the county. Their mapped distribution is useful when a project needs to compare upland forest with lower, wetter ground, although this page is not a flood-hazard or wetland-jurisdiction map. For environmental education, the simplified view is particularly useful because the major vegetation and agricultural groups can be compared without the developed classes drawing as much attention.

Annual NLCD is a 30-meter raster dataset, so its cells generalize the landscape. Narrow roads, small buildings, tiny ponds, mixed forest edges, and individual field boundaries may be simplified or assigned to the dominant nearby class. That scale is appropriate for countywide patterns and broad comparisons, but it should not be used as a substitute for a parcel survey, a timber-stand inventory, or a farm acreage measurement.

Howard County’s mean impervious surface is 1.31%, and only 0.51% of the county is mapped at 50% impervious or higher. The developed-land share is 6.64%. These numbers fit the visual impression: most of the county is light on the impervious map, while several compact clusters of orange and red identify places with more pavement, roofs, and other hard surfaces.

A noticeable concentration appears near the center of the county, and the largest cluster is in the southeast. With Nashville identified as the county seat by the Association of Arkansas Counties, the southeastern developed area provides a useful reference point for understanding how settlement occupies only part of a largely forested and agricultural county. Thin lines of slightly higher imperviousness also follow road routes through otherwise low-impervious areas.

Impervious percentage and the developed land-cover class should not be treated as interchangeable measurements. Developed land is a categorical cover class, while imperviousness estimates the fraction of a cell covered by hard surfaces such as pavement and rooftops. A residential cell can be classified as developed without being completely impervious, which is why the 6.64% developed share and the 1.31% mean impervious value answer different questions.

The 1985–2025 comparison marks 39.17% of the county as having a different mapped class between the two dates. Within that total, 1.38% is classified as a change to developed land, 13.02% as forest loss, 1.41% as agricultural loss, and 23.02% as other class differences. Orange forest-loss cells and purple other-difference cells are widespread in the northern and central portions of the county, while the south contains larger areas with no mapped class difference.

A 39.17% class-difference value is not a 39.17% development rate. The change-to-developed category is only 1.38%, and the map explicitly separates forest loss, agricultural loss, and other differences. Classification changes can also reflect how a cell was labeled in each observation year rather than a single simple land-use story. The large 23.02% “other difference” category is a good reason to avoid attributing the whole change figure to one cause.

The most useful approach is to compare the change view with the 2025 cover map. Northern areas can contain many difference cells while still being predominantly forest today. Likewise, agricultural cover in the southeast should be interpreted from the current map before the historical comparison is discussed. Keeping “current condition” and “change between two dates” separate makes reports and presentations much clearer.

Choosing the right view for a project

For a quick county overview, begin with the general 2025 classification and identify the broad forested north and the more agricultural southeast. The forest-and-farmland view is better when vegetation and farming are the main subjects. Switch to the impervious layer when settlement patterns, roads, rooftops, or runoff-related context matter, and use the change comparison only after the current pattern is understood.

Teachers can use the maps to ask students why one county can be both heavily forested and agriculturally important. Environmental reports can place the general cover next to the impervious view to distinguish large natural areas from compact developed centers. Habitat or watershed discussions can use the wetland and water classes as orientation, but any regulatory wetland boundary, flood zone, or water-quality conclusion needs the appropriate official dataset rather than this generalized classification alone.
